--- Begin Message ---Subject: Re: bug#28446: address@hidden should select 4.1.x, not 4.13.x Date: Sun, 13 May 2018 13:31:08 +0200 User-agent: Gnus/5.13 (Gnus v5.13) Emacs/25.3 (gnu/linux) Hello, Mark H Weaver <address@hidden> skribis: > Ricardo Wurmus <address@hidden> writes: > >>> Currently, the package specification "address@hidden" selects version >>> 4.13. It should instead select version 4.1. >> >> We consider everthing following the address@hidden a version string prefix. >> Since >> versions are arbitrary strings “4.1” is considered a valid prefix of >> “4.13”. If a user supplied the version string “4.1.” they would get the >> appropriate package. I pushed a fix that I think does what we want as 348987d3d12ebaf11fdbcc3dbd56585e7d69a1f5. Basically ‘version-prefix?’ splits a version string at dots and compares whole components. Thanks, Ludo’.
